Zhejiang Tiantai Pumped Storage Power Station

The first warehouse of low-heat concrete of Zhejiang Tiantai Pumped Storage Power Station was successfully poured, which is the first application of low-heat concrete in the pumped storage industry, and has a demonstration and leading role.

The rated head of the Tiantai pumped storage power station is 724 meters, the highest in the world, the capacity of a single unit is 425,000 kilowatts, ranking first in China, and the length of the upper and lower diversion inclined wells is 483.4 meters, which will refresh a number of records in the construction process. The total installed capacity of the power station is 1.7 million kilowatts, and the annual power generation is expected to be 1.7 billion kilowatt hours after completion, which can save about 520,000 tons of standard coal and reduce carbon dioxide emissions by about 1.04 million tons every year, with significant ecological and environmental benefits.

Qinghai Warang Pumped Storage Power Station

Qinghai Wa, the pumped storage power station with the largest installed capacity in the western region, has brought the construction of the pumped storage power station into the full construction stage.

The power station is located in Guomaying Town, Guinan County, Hainan Prefecture, and is a key implementation project of the national "14th Five-Year Plan". The total installed capacity is 2.8 million kilowatts, with an annual electricity consumption of 4.48 billion kilowatt-hours and a power generation capacity of 3.36 billion kilowatt-hours. After completion and operation, it can save about 1.82 million tons of standard coal and reduce carbon dioxide emissions by about 4.55 million tons per year.

Xinjiang Fukang Pumped Storage Power Station

Unit 3 of Fukang Pumped Storage Power Station, the first pumped storage power station in Xinjiang, was put into operation for power generation.

The power station is the first project in the domestic pumped storage industry to adopt the EPC general contracting management model, with a total installed capacity of 1.2 million kilowatts. After completion, it can generate 2.6 billion kWh of new energy per year, reduce the consumption of standard coal by about 165,000 tons, and reduce carbon dioxide emissions by about 496,000 tons, which is of great significance for promoting the construction of a large-scale comprehensive energy base in Xinjiang and helping Xinjiang power transmission.

Shandong Wendeng Pumped Storage Power Station

Wendeng Pumped Storage Power Station, the largest pumped storage power station in Shandong, has passed the completion safety appraisal and basically has normal operating conditions.

The power station is located in Jieshi Town, Wendeng District, Weihai City, Shandong Province, with a total installed capacity of 1.8 million kilowatts and a designed annual power generation capacity of 2.71 billion kilowatt hours, which can meet the annual electricity consumption of 1.06 million households. After the completion of the power station, it can save about 130,000 tons of standard coal and reduce carbon dioxide emissions by about 310,000 tons per year.

Shandong Tai'an Pumped Storage Power Station

The concrete pouring of the first warehouse of the rock anchor beam of the underground plant of Shandong Tai'an Pumped Storage Power Station was successfully completed, and the concrete pouring of the rock anchor beam of the main plant was officially started.

The designed installed capacity of the power station is 1.8 million kilowatts, and six 300,000 kilowatt reversible pump turbine generator sets are installed. After completion and operation, it can save about 650,000 tons of standard coal and reduce carbon dioxide emissions by about 1.3 million tons every year, and the energy saving and environmental protection benefits are more significant.

Zhejiang Pan'an Pumped Storage Power Station

The tail gate tunnel of State Grid Xinyuan Zhejiang Pan'an Pumped Storage Power Station was successfully completed.

The power station is the recommended site of the "13th Five-Year Plan" of Zhejiang Pumped Storage Power Station, which is a pure pumped storage power station for daily regulation. The installed capacity of the power station is 1.2 million kilowatts, and the designed annual power generation capacity is 1.2 billion kilowatt hours.

Xinjiang Hami Pumped Storage Power Station

The No. 3 tunnel of Xinjiang Hami Pumped Storage Power Station was successfully completed.

The power station is located in Tianshan Township, northeast of Hami City, Xinjiang, with a total installed capacity of 1.2 million kilowatts, an annual power generation of 1.368 billion kilowatt hours, which can save about 240,000 tons of standard coal and reduce carbon dioxide emissions by about 600,000 tons.
